RESOLUTION: 2008-56
SUBJECT: Authorizing the City to enter into a Revocable License Agreement with the Fossil Ridge Metropolitan District No. 1 for the installation and maintenance of a solar array and related facilities on City property within Forsberg Iron Spring Park and in the right-of-way for West Evans Avenue.
ADDRESS: Forsberg Iron Spring Park, adjacent to West Evans Avenue, Lakewood,
Colorado
RECOMMENDATION: Adopt the Resolution authorizing the City Manager to execute
a Revocable License Agreement with the Fossil Ridge Metropolitan District No.
1 for the installation of a solar array in a portion of Forsberg Iron Spring
Park.
FUNDING SOURCE: N/A. Fossil Ridge Metropolitan District No. 1 will fund the
installation and maintenance of the equipment authorized by the License Agreement.
SUMMARY AND BACKGROUND OF SUBJECT MATTER: This Resolution would authorize the
execution of a Revocable License Agreement with the Fossil Ridge Metropolitan
District No. 1, which serves the new Solterra development, to install and maintain
an array of solar panels on a portion of Forsberg Iron Spring Park. Related
facilities, specifically electric lines, would also extend into a portion of
the right-of-way for West Evans Avenue. The City Charter specifically authorizes
the granting of easements for utility purposes across City parkland. A revocable
license agreement allows the use of the property for utility purposes without
conveying any actually interest in the land.
